In the ever-evolving world of scientific research and medical advancements, the need for effective storage and management of biological materials has become increasingly crucial. Cryostorage, the process of preserving cells, tissues, and other biological samples at ultra-low temperatures, has become a cornerstone in modern research and healthcare. To ensure the integrity of these samples, proper storage and inventory management is essential. This is where a cryostorage inventory system plays a critical role.

A cryostorage inventory system is a sophisticated software tool designed to track, manage, and organize samples stored in cryogenic conditions. These systems provide researchers, clinicians, and laboratory staff with a streamlined and efficient solution for managing the vast amounts of biological materials stored in cryogenic freezers.

One of the key advantages of a cryostorage inventory system is its ability to eliminate manual record-keeping and reduce the risk of errors associated with human intervention. By automating the storage and tracking of samples, researchers can significantly reduce the time and effort required to manage their inventories. This not only improves operational efficiency but also minimizes the risk of losing or misplacing valuable samples.

Furthermore, a cryostorage inventory system offers detailed information about each sample, including its location within the cryogenic freezer, the date of storage, and any relevant metadata associated with the sample. This level of data accuracy and accessibility is invaluable for maintaining sample integrity and ensuring compliance with industry regulations and best practices.

When selecting a cryostorage inventory system, it is essential to consider several factors to ensure that the chosen solution meets the specific needs of your organization. These factors include scalability, integration with existing laboratory equipment and software, user-friendly interface, and technical support services.

Scalability is a critical consideration when choosing a cryostorage inventory system, as it determines the system’s ability to accommodate the growth of your sample inventory over time. An ideal system should be able to scale seamlessly to support increasing sample volumes and users without compromising performance or data integrity.

Integration with existing laboratory equipment and software is another key factor to consider when selecting a cryostorage inventory system. A system that can easily connect with your cryogenic freezers, barcode scanners, and other laboratory devices will streamline data capture and ensure seamless data exchange between systems.

A user-friendly interface is essential for ensuring the successful adoption of a cryostorage inventory system within your organization. A system that is intuitive and easy to navigate will encourage staff to use the system consistently and accurately, leading to improved data quality and operational efficiency.

Lastly, technical support services are crucial for ensuring the ongoing functionality and reliability of your cryostorage inventory system. Choose a vendor that offers comprehensive support services, including training, troubleshooting, and regular software updates, to maximize the value of your investment.
